I'd say there has to be something wrong with your code. Both errors are related to doing updates (probably player:update()) while teleporting. It shouldn't be doing that. Your code for teleporting should wait until the teleporting is complete before giving player:update a chance to run again. That or you have a userfunction with a registered timer that includes a player:update(). But still, if you are using waitForLoadingScreen() then registered timers shouldn't be a problem because waitForLoadingScreen() doesn't yield. So how are you doing your teleporting?

player:target targets a pawn or pawn address. Eg.

Code: Select all

local dummy = player:findNearestNameOrId(105243)
player:target(dummy)
